Alert: partition-missing-next-month. The Tollgrave events table is partitioned by month, and the partition for the upcoming month has not been created. The provisioning job normally runs on the 25th; if it failed, inserts will start erroring at month rollover. Check the partition-maker cron logs and create the partition manually if needed — the command is idempotent. This must be resolved before the 1st. The manual creation procedure is documented here.

dashboard of kafop-yagep = https://jira.zemvarsys.internal/pages/pages/pages/display/cc87

# Break-Glass: Parcelwire Webhook

If the Parcelwire parcel-tracking webhook signer is unreachable and deliveries stall, break-glass applies. Page the on-call, confirm outage in the Kestrel dashboard, then unseal the standby signing vault. Log every action in the incident channel. Access auto-expires after two hours. Re-seal immediately once normal signing resumes. The recovery passphrase for the standby vault follows below.

unlock words, fahip-tagag: druix-oliox-oliox

- [ ] Verify the Lumenwick retention sweeper signing key before sealing the envelope. As the new contractor, confirm the key fingerprint against the printed manifest with the ceremony officer present, then initial the margin. If the sweeper's vault must ever be restored without the officer, use the recovery passphrase recorded immediately below this item.

unlock words, kagef-taduf: fenir-quenix-norwyn-sorvan-gormir-gorir-fraok